    Common Lock Problems

    Before diving into repair methods, let’s first determine some typical lock issues that property owners might experience.

    Issue
    Description

    Sticking Key
    The key struggles to kip down the lock or feels jammed.

    Loose or Wobbly Lock
    The lock feels loose or wobbles when the key is inserted.

    Key Won’t Turn
    The key can not be turned, even if placed correctly.

    Lock Won’t Engage
    The bolt does not move into the door frame.

    Rust or Corrosion
    Visible rust or corrosion impacts the operation of the lock.

    Broken Key
    A snapped or broken key that stays stuck in the lock.

    Step-by-Step Lock Repair Methods

    Depending upon the problem at hand, different methods are needed for lock repairs. Below are methods categorized by typical issues.

    1. Sticking Key

    Signs: A key that sticks might not go into smoothly or turn quickly.

    Repair Steps:

    • Lubricate the Lock: Use a graphite lubricant, which is more effective to oil, as it will not draw in dirt. Use it sparingly to the key and insert it into the lock a few times.
    • Clean the Key: Ensure that there’s no debris on the key that might cause sticking. Clean both the key and the lock with a wire brush if needed.

    2. Loose or Wobbly Lock

    Symptoms: The entire lock system feels loose or wobbles when the key is turned.

    Repair Steps:

    • Tighten Screws: Use a screwdriver to tighten up any screws on the faceplate. Make sure all screws are safely fastened.
    • Examine the Strike Plate: If the lock bolts do not line up with the strike plate, changes or adjustment may be required.

    3. Key Won’t Turn

    Signs: The key is placed however can not turn.

    Repair Steps:

    • Inspect the Key: If it’s bent or harmed, it may need to be replaced.
    • Oil: Apply lube to the key and the lock, then carefully wiggle the key while attempting to turn it.
    • Remove the Lock: If the problem persists, get rid of the lock and look for any internal clogs or issues.

    4. Lock Won’t Engage

    Signs: The bolt does not pull back or engage correctly.

    Repair Steps:

    • Inspect Mechanism: Remove the lock from the door and inspect the internal system for any damaged parts.
    • Change Broken Parts: If any springs are harmed or springs are missing out on, they need to be changed.
    • Examine Alignment: Ensure that the lock aligns effectively with the strike plate.

    5. Rust or Corrosion

    Symptoms: Rust or rust may produce sticky locks or prevent operation.

    Repair Steps:

    • Clean the Lock Housing: Use a wire brush to get rid of rust from both the lock and surrounding locations.
    • Apply Rust Inhibitor: Once cleaned up, applying a rust inhibitor will help avoid future incidents.
    • Oil: Finish with a correct lubricant inside the lock.

    6. Broken Key

    Symptoms: A key that has actually broken off in the lock.

    Repair Steps:

    • Use Pliers: If enough of the key is extending, utilize pliers to grip and pull it out.
    • Key Extractor Tool: If it’s lodged, a key extractor can aid in getting rid of the broken piece.
    • Professional Help: If both methods fail, consider looking for the aid of a locksmith.

    FAQs About House Lock Repair

    1. How often should I service my locks?

    Regular maintenance is encouraged, ideally every year or whenever you discover issues emerging.

    2. Can I replace my lock myself?

    Yes, numerous property owners can change locks with standard DIY abilities. Follow the producer’s instructions carefully.

    3. How do I select the ideal locksmith if I need one?

    Look for licensed, insured, and respectable locksmiths in your location. Reading evaluations can likewise supply insights into their service quality.

    4. What should I do if my key is stuck in the lock?

    Attempt very gently to wiggle the key while pulling it out. If this stops working, think about utilizing a key extractor or speaking with a locksmith to avoid damage.

    5. Exist specific lubes I should avoid using on locks?

    Prevent oil-based lubricants as they can bring in dust and gunk, resulting in more problems in the long run.
